#20ab69 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#20ab69 is composed of 12.5% red, 67.1%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.6%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 151.5 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 39.8%. #20ab69 color hex could be obtained by blending #40ffd2 with #005700.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#20ab69 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#20ab69 has RGB values of R:32, G:171,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 2141033.

Shades and Tints of #20ab69

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010604 is the darkest color, while #f4fdf9 is the lightest one.
